REFLECTION

Experience:
Through these 14 weeks, it was an exciting and enjoyable journey. With limited resources, we manage to learn independently through online platforms with an effective guide from Mr.Fauzi. Sometimes, I struggled to come out with ideas and felt lost in the middle. I truly appreciated the feedbacks and words of encouragement from Mr. Fauzi. Learning in a positive environment had driven my motivation to do my best in every single task.  

Observation:
Time management is crucial when it comes to handling multiple tasks at once, completing all the weekly tasks and exercises as well as updating the E-portfolio. Furthermore, Mr Fauzi's tip to document files is really useful and it trained us to be more organize and systematic. It was fantastic to learn about Mr. Fauzi's real-life experiences and initiatives, which helped us to prepare for the industrial.

Findings:
At first, I thought this module would be mainly about photography. To my surprise, it is way broader than I expected. We have learned about the golden ratio, rule of thirds and visual hierarchy to build a good design composition. All of these theories and techniques require consistent practice to improve the quality of work. As this module conducted fully online, self initiatives are important in researching extra references to enhance the knowledge that we have learned.
